Tai O Heritage Hotel

Take a trip down memory lane at the newly opened Tai O Heritage Hotel!  The Old Tai O Police Station, built in 1902, has been revitalized and converted into Tai O Heritage Hotel to celebrate Hong Kong cultural heritage.

The quaint family-friendly hotel with nine colonial-style rooms and suites is located in the Tai O fishing village known for houses on stilts. The hotel houses the Heritage Interpretation Centre, an exhibition area displaying the history of the former police station and Tai O people. It also features Tai O Lookout, a glass-roofed restaurant serving Tai O specialties and displaying artwork by local Tai O artists.
